What is Elbow Pain (Tennis Elbow & Golf Elbow)?

Tennis elbow (lateral epicondylitis) and golf elbow (medial epicondylitis) are conditions that cause pain due to inflammation in the muscles and tendons caused by overuse of the elbow. These symptoms can occur not only in sports but also through repetitive actions in daily life, such as computer work, lifting heavy objects, or household chores.

Main Symptoms of Elbow Pain

  • Pain on the outer or inner side of the elbow when gripping and lifting objects
  • Pain when wringing a towel or turning a doorknob
  • Headaches
  • Pain in the elbow that radiates when moving fingers or wrists
  • No pain at rest, but pain when moving the elbow

If these symptoms are left untreated, they can interfere with daily life, and recovery may take time.
